Output 9d41e23ec3e631d78d77c119ea196c74994aba01a0a815522bc39c6dce422596:0

value
29621627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ad34187e75916b2bd58a48aed287a212f2d9464 OP_EQUAL
address
3EM4FLdDYhBpAhwArE8yTJmfQhQN2XCqPk
transaction
9d41e23ec3e631d78d77c119ea196c74994aba01a0a815522bc39c6dce422596
spent
true